The Holyland Model of Jerusalem, also known as Model of Jerusalem at the end of the Second Temple period ( Hebrew: דגם ירושלים בסוף ימי בית שני) is a 1:50 scale model of the city of Jerusalem in the late Second Temple period. The model, designed by Michael Avi-Yonah, [1] was moved from its original location at the ... Apr 25, 2017 · In the later Bronze period, Jerusalem was the capital of a modest city-state and a part of the Egyptian Empire. The city expanded under the pharaohs Seti I and Ramses II. The capital was captured by King David around 1004 BC and became a holy city. His son Solomon first built the temple named after himself. In the Sixth Century BC, Babylonian ... The siege of Jerusalem during the First Crusade lasted for one month and eight days, from 7 June 1099 to 15 July 1099. Many antique maps of the Holy Land were more artistic imaginings than scientific renderings, with Jerusalem often placed at the center of the world. The maps shown here portray the Holy Land divided according to the twelve tribes of ancient Israel. These maps were usually …In 1629, W.J. Blaeu printed a new world atlas containing 45 maps. One of these was a map of the Holy Land as seen by Moses from Mt. Nevo just before his death and after forty years of wandering with the Israelites in the desert.The cartouche on the bottom right is surrounded by the figures of Moses and Aaron.
